Wentzville, MO has another Board of Alderman meeting on Feb 8 at 6:30 PM. We were previously told that the BSL repeal would be introduced at this meeting, but it does not appear to be on the agenda. However, they discussed this issue extensively at the last meeting even though it was not on the agenda last time either. If you are a resident, please make every effort to attend the board meeting and show your support for BSL repeal.
You can read the draft ordinance here. It is breed-neutral and, if passed, would repeal the city’s current “pit bull” restrictions. However, it is not unanimously favored and there is some opposition to BSL repeal.
